Subject: On-call handoff — Larkspur audit-log viewer

Hi Dena,

Welcome to the rotation. The Larkspur audit-log viewer is read-only for everyone except the compliance group; most pages you'll get are about export timeouts, not data integrity. If a security reviewer asks about tamper-evidence, point them to the hash-chain verification job, which runs hourly. Access requests go through the standard approval flow, and the runbook covering common failure modes lives here:

wiki page, bagaf-fawip: https://harbor.tolvaqsys.local/pages/repo/pages/secrets/eac969ffc71f356b

Welcome aboard! The Lintwell consent banner rollout is gated per-region, so the release manager flips flags in `banner.env` before each wave. Copy the sample file, set `REGION_WAVE` and the rollout percentage, then double-check the CDN purge toggle. Right after those, the banner service's API credential gets its own line:

sealed setting: RELAY_SECRET13=bca49b02a6971

- [ ] Step 7: Archive cold storage buckets (Glacierline tier). Confirm both ceremony witnesses are present, verify bucket manifests match the Oxbow ledger, then seal the archive key shares. Plugin authors may observe but not handle shares. Once sealed, the archive index itself is encrypted and can only be reopened with the passphrase below.

vault phrase of badup-hahig = tamael-aldael-kelmir-istael-fenok-istwyn-tamius-jorath-oliion

Finance Review — Q3 Summary, Velmora Expansion

For the incoming director: entry into the Keldar Coast region cost 12% over plan, driven by warehouse retrofits in Port Anselm. Revenue ramp is two months behind forecast but unit margins are on target. Hedley's team cut logistics spend by 8% since August. Recommend holding further capex until Q1 numbers land. Staffing is adequate; local licensing is complete. One item requires discretion, set out in the confidential note below.

board note of tadup-tajog: Headcount on the Oliiel team goes from 31 to 88 by the end of February. Gross margin on Oliiel came in at 62 percent against a plan of 29 percent.